- [ ] Step 7: Archive cold storage buckets (Glacierline tier). Confirm both ceremony witnesses are present, verify bucket manifests match the Oxbow ledger, then seal the archive key shares. Plugin authors may observe but not handle shares. Once sealed, the archive index itself is encrypted and can only be reopened with the passphrase below.

vault phrase of badup-hahig = tamael-aldael-kelmir-istael-fenok-istwyn-tamius-jorath-oliion

Ticket: InkPress renderer rejecting plugin uploads

Several external plugin authors report that the PDF invoice renderer (InkPress) returns authorization failures when fetching font bundles. Investigation confirms the shared credential for the FontVault service expired on the 3rd and was never rotated. This blocks all invoice previews that use custom typefaces. A replacement credential has been provisioned with a twelve-month lifetime. For affected plugin authors, the new key appears directly below.

service key, yajep-bahaf: kto2_gq

# PortionPal — recipe-scaling calculator, env config
# Welcome aboard. This file drives the local dev instance. Scaling logic
# lives in the converter service; unit tables are cached from the Grammet
# ingredient registry on first run. Defaults below match staging, so don't
# change rounding mode or yield factors without checking with the team.
# The registry sync requires an access credential, which is injected here
# rather than in code. The required credential line follows immediately below.

sealed setting: LEDGER_TOKEN5=b395a

Minutes — Management Meeting, Reseller Programme

Attendees: T. Marwick, L. Obrenna, S. Feldt. Korvix Systems' reseller tiers were reviewed; bronze tier margins confirmed as too thin. Onboarding for the Aldstone partners moves to next quarter. Training materials to be refreshed by L. Obrenna. The following note is confidential to sales leads only.

confidential, kajof-tahof: The pricing group signed off on a budget of $491.8 million for Project Casvan.